Physical and Chemical Properties

Top
Molecular Formula C20H10O6
Molecular Weight 346.30 g/mol
Exact Mass 346.04773803 g/mol
Topological Polar Surface Area (TPSA) 115.00 Ų
XlogP 2.80
Atomic LogP (AlogP) 2.62
H-Bond Acceptor 6
H-Bond Donor 4
Rotatable Bonds 0
